K.SURENDRA MOHAN
Sebastian Jose – Appellant
Versus
Indian Overseas Bank Ltd. – Respondent
K. Surendra Mohan, J.—The first respondent, Indian Overseas Bank Ltd. filed a suit O.S. 77/2003 for the realisation of amounts due from the revision petitioner who was an employee of the Bank. The allegation is that the revision petitioner had during the course of his employment with the bank, committed misappropriation of funds of the Bank. On the very same allegations the C.B.I. conducted an investigation and launched prosecution proceedings against the revision petitioner, in which it is reported that he has been convicted. The misappropriation is stated to be to the tune of Rs. 75,63,295/-. The Bank initiated disciplinary proceedings against the revision petitioner and has terminated his services. The Bank also filed the suit from which the above revision arises for recovery of the amounts misappropriated by the revision petitioner.
2. The petitioner is a subscriber to life insurance policies. The petitioner had kept these policies in his cabin, while he was working with the first respondent-bank.
